5. How to Achieve the Perfect, Streak-Free Tan with a Tanning Bed
Tanning beds provide a smooth, even tan, but following a proper tanning routine ensures that your results are long-lasting and flawless.
Step-by-Step Guide to the Perfect Tan
- Exfoliate Before Your Session – Use a gentle body scrub to remove dead skin cells, ensuring an even tan.
- Apply a Tanning Accelerator Lotion – This boosts melanin production and hydrates your skin.
- Position Yourself Evenly in the Tanning Bed – Rotate occasionally to prevent uneven tan lines.
- Time Your Sessions Correctly – Avoid overexposure, especially if you’re new to tanning.
- Hydrate and Moisturize Post-Tan – Drink plenty of water and apply a nourishing moisturizer to keep your skin soft and glowing.
